Jimmy Fallon Salary 2024: How Much Is He Paid?

Jimmy Fallon commands one of the highest paychecks in late night, driven by his long tenure on The Tonight Show and strong ratings for NBC. Understanding his compensation requires looking at salary, bonuses, and the broader financial structure of his show.

Below is a focused breakdown of how much Jimmy Fallon is paid and the key elements that shape his earnings.

Compensation Component Estimated Annual Value Source or Basis Notes
Base Salary $15–20 million Industry reports and prior filings Core fixed pay for hosting The Tonight Show
Performance Bonuses $2–5 million Ratings milestones and anniversary commitments Tied to show performance and longevity
NBC Universal Package Health, retirement, and equity benefits Union and public filings Significant non-cash value
External Deals and Podcasts $1–3 million Spotify, Netflix, and guest appearances Incremental income outside the base contract

Comparison with Other Late Night Hosts

Jimmy Fallon sits at the top of late night pay scales, though competitors maintain strong packages as well. The differences reflect tenure, show format, and network priorities.

tr>
Host Network Estimated Annual Pay TenureJimmy Fallon NBC $17–25 million Since 2014
Stephen Colbert CBS $12–18 million Since 2015
Jimmy Kimmel ABC $12–20 million Since 2012
James Corden CBS $8–12 million 2015–2023
